Output 75b44ae81cec3c31e19f2ca442903b8feb6ed315be09ea0dfab8180c38584faf:0

value
12046643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ef6754e6a1746862e8e17de38a44bd9ad8524ee OP_EQUAL
address
3348dStoua4zqcgvQHC8MrS57ogxmkeCA2
transaction
75b44ae81cec3c31e19f2ca442903b8feb6ed315be09ea0dfab8180c38584faf
spent
true